Day 02. Tarangire National Park – A Wilderness of Giants
1 nights

Introduction
After a delightful breakfast, drive through scenic Maasai lands to Tarangire National Park, famed for its large elephant herds, giant baobab trees, and unspoiled landscapes. The park’s savannahs are alive with zebra, wildebeest, giraffes, and predators like lions and leopards. A delicious picnic lunch inside the park ensures you don’t miss a moment of the action. Later in the evening, unwind at your eco-lodge with sundowners and locally inspired cuisine.Your Stay

Day 06. Cultural safari in hadzabe and Mto wa mbu maasai tribe visit
1 nights

Introduction
Your day begins with an early drive to the shores of Lake Eyasi, home to the Hadzabe people, one of Africa’s last remaining true hunter-gatherer tribes. Living much as they have for thousands of years, the Hadzabe offer a rare and authentic cultural encounter. In the afternoon, journey into the highlands or plains near Manyara or Ngorongoro for a visit to a traditional Maasai Boma (homestead). The Maasai are Tanzania’s most iconic tribe — known for their bright red shúkà robes, beadwork, and warrior spirit. Your Stay
